Output 77e0110680140875fdbd8d79be4fabb436b91260cf4f485aa406a866e234f03b:1

value
26776972
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e57c24c69c9e4533dc009c7e68ec399895d8c86f OP_EQUALVERIFY OP_CHECKSIG
address
1MvQTajQwA4L1e35yFrUrDTjsZMAd1A231
transaction
77e0110680140875fdbd8d79be4fabb436b91260cf4f485aa406a866e234f03b
spent
true